Plans are well underway for the UEFA Champions League Final airlift with hundreds of extra flights to and from Cardiff Airport across the 2nd, 3rd & 4th June.

Cardiff Airport (CWL/EGFF) has been planning for this event for some time and have special plans in place such as positioning empty aircraft to other airfields to ease ramp congestion at Wales’ National Airport.

The UEFA Champions League final will be played at Wales’ National Stadium in Cardiff on Saturday 3rd June with Italian side Juventus taking on Spanish giants Real Madrid.

Cardiff will be receiving primarily Juventus fans although some Real Madrid fans will be arriving into the Welsh Hub. Bristol Airport (BRS/EGGD) will be the opposite, receiving primarily Real Madrid fans with a few flights from Italy.

A regular ferry service from Bristol Airport across to Cardiff Heliport is also planned along with VIP helicopters arriving.

Other airports including Gloucestershire Airport (GLO/EGBJ) and Cotswold Airport (GBA/EGBP) are expecting a large influx of business jets and general aviation traffic.

Cardiff is starting to see signs of the sporting event with automotive sponsor Nissan seen flying an Nissan X-Trail across the city for a PR event earlier this week.
